Evaluating Raleigh against Ottawa surfaces important distinctions across cost, connectivity, and legal parameters:
- Financial Variance: Remote workers targeting cost efficiency gravitate toward Ottawa, where monthly living expenses run 7% below Raleigh.
- Connectivity Speed: Internet performance tilts toward Raleigh with 477.9 Mbps download speeds, notably higher than Ottawa’s 445.5 Mbps offering.
- Safety Index: Safety indices (on a 0–100 scale) rate Ottawa at 69 and Raleigh at 51. A higher safety score correlates with lower residential risk.
- Legal Path: While Ottawa enables streamlined long-term stays via a formal nomad visa, Raleigh currently lacks a comparable program.
